The Itinerary: From Market to Meal in a Cozy Home

This private cooking class begins in the heart of Ferrara at Pasticceria Cioccolateria Chocolat. Meeting here is convenient, especially if you’re already exploring Ferrara’s charming streets, and it sets a lovely tone with a sweet treat or coffee. From this starting point, you’ll set off on foot to visit three historic shops: a butcher, a greengrocer, and a specialty shop focused on regional products. These stops are more than just shopping; they’re a lesson in local sourcing and culinary traditions.

The shop visits are a highlight, especially if you’re curious about how authentic ingredients are selected and cared for in Ferrarese cuisine. Both Sofia and Matteo seem to take pride in supporting local vendors, which adds value to the experience. As you browse, you’ll learn about regional produce and typical ingredients that define Ferrarese dishes — a small, immersive cultural lesson with delicious smells.

After gathering ingredients, you’ll head to the hosts’ home — a warm, welcoming space that becomes your own for the afternoon. Upon arrival, a welcome glass of wine from the area’s cellars sets a relaxed, convivial tone. Then, don aprons and dive into cooking a full menu: starting with an appetizer, followed by homemade pasta, a second course with sides, and finishing with dessert. The menu is thoughtfully crafted to showcase local flavors and cooking techniques.

Practical Details: What You Need to Know

  • The tour lasts roughly five hours, providing ample time to shop, cook, and enjoy your meal without feeling rushed.
  • The meeting point is centrally located, making it easy for most travelers to access.
  • It’s not recommended for those allergic to dogs and cats, as the hosts’ home environment includes pets.
  • Pickup is offered, adding convenience, especially if you’re staying outside the city center.
  • The experience is only for your group, ensuring privacy and personalized attention.
  • Free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ance means you can plan with confidence.
